METHOD OF RECORDING IMAGES ON A RADIATION SENSITIVE MATERIAL Abstract of the Disclosure A method of recording images on a radiation sensi- material comprising forming a layer of a radiation sensitive material comprised of a heterogeneous mixture of substances. At least one of the substances of the heterogeneous mixture serves as a solvent capable of con- verting its states of aggregation in the mixture under the action of the intrinsic or reflected radiation ob- tainable from the object being recorded. Another substance of the heterogeneous mixture, in the form of particles, is capable-of interacting with a force field. The layer is introduced in a force field and an image of the object being recorded is projected on that layer. The produced image is fixed by converting the state of aggregation of the heterogeneous mixture. The proposed method makes it possible to record images in any spectral range of the intrinsic and reflected radiation of the object. Images of any objects can be recorded on that layer containing no silver halides.
